The Global Resonance and the Unprecedented Anfield Tribute
Football rivalries are notoriously toxic, laced with decades of bitterness and tribal warfare. Yet, what happened just one day after the announcement, on April 19, 2022, at Anfield stadium during a match between Liverpool and Manchester United, shattered the conventional playbook of sports animosity. I watched that moment unfold, and frankly, it was the first time in years the sport felt genuinely human. During the seventh minute of the match—matching Ronaldo’s iconic jersey number—the entire stadium stood up to applaud.
Breaking the Tribalism of English Football
The Liverpool supporters, historically the fiercest antagonists of anyone wearing a Manchester United shirt, sang their legendary anthem, "You’ll Never Walk Alone," with a visceral intensity. It was an astonishing display of collective empathy that transcended points tables and tactical rivalries. Ronaldo, who was understandably absent from the squad to be with Georgina and their children, later expressed his deep gratitude online, noting that he and his family would never forget that moment of respect and compassion. Analyzing the Immediate Impact on His Professional Career
Returning to elite physical competition after a psychological trauma of this magnitude is an uncharted territory for most human beings. Ronaldo returned to training on April 20, 2022, a mere two days after the public announcement. To some, this rapid return seemed incomprehensible—perhaps even cold—but work often serves as a necessary sanctuary from overwhelming domestic sorrow. His first game back was against Arsenal on April 23, where he scored his 100th Premier League goal, dedicating the milestone to his late son by pointing solemnly to the heavens.

Navigating the digital rumor mill: Common misconceptions
The internet rarely handles nuance well, which explains why the tragic loss Cristiano Ronaldo and Georgina Rodriguez experienced in April 2022 frequently gets distorted. A primary point of confusion centers on which child passed away, as many casual observers mistakenly believe the couple lost an older son. Let's be clear: their eldest child, Cristiano Ronaldo Jr., born in 2010, is perfectly healthy and actively pursuing his own football career. The tragedy actually involved the heartbreaking loss of a newborn twin boy during childbirth, while his twin sister, Bella Esmeralda, survived. Misidentifying the victim of this tragedy remains a persistent error across social media algorithms that thrive on sensationalism rather than fact.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which of Cristiano Ronaldo's children passed away?
The tragedy occurred on April 18, 2022, when Cristiano Ronaldo and Georgina Rodriguez announced the devastating passing of their newborn infant son. The couple was expecting twins, but while their daughter Bella Esmeralda was delivered safely, her twin brother tragically died during childbirth. This profound loss prompted an outpouring of global support, including a touching tribute from 54,000 fans during a Premier League match at Anfield. The family has never publicly disclosed the specific medical complications that led to the infant's death, choosing instead to focus on healing and celebrating the life of their surviving daughter.
How many children does Cristiano Ronaldo currently have?
Following the events of 2022, the multi-time Ballon d'Or winner is a dedicated father to five living children. His eldest, Cristiano Jr., is currently 15 years old and playing in youth academies, followed by twins Eva and Mateo, who were born via surrogate in June 2017. Alana Martina, his first child with Rodriguez, was born in November 2017, and Bella Esmeralda, the surviving twin from the 2022 delivery, completes the family. This brings the total household count to three daughters and two sons, creating a bustling, supportive environment that the footballer frequently showcases to his 600 million plus social media followers.
How did football fans react to the family tragedy?
The sports world displayed unprecedented solidarity, completely castigating traditional club rivalries in the wake of the devastating announcement. During a Manchester United versus Liverpool fixture just one day after the news broke, the entire stadium initiated a minutes-long applause during the seventh minute of play. This specific timing was chosen to honor the iconic number 7 jersey worn by the Portuguese forward throughout his legendary career.
